Legitimate Avenues for Earning Robux (Indirectly)
While no app directly hands out free Robux, some platforms offer rewards that can be converted into Robux. These are typically survey sites or "get-paid-to" (GPT) apps that reward users for completing tasks such as surveys, watching videos, or downloading and testing other apps.
It's crucial to understand that these methods don't provide Robux directly. Instead, they offer points or cash that can be redeemed for gift cards, which can then be used to purchase Robux on the official Roblox platform.
Reputable GPT apps and sites include those operated by well-known survey companies. However, even these require significant time and effort for relatively small rewards.
The Google Opinion Rewards App
One example is the Google Opinion Rewards app. Users earn Google Play Credits for completing short surveys. These credits can then be used to purchase Robux on the Roblox mobile app.
This is arguably one of the safer and more legitimate ways to indirectly acquire Robux without spending real money. However, the earnings are modest and surveys are not always available.
The Dangers of Robux Generator Apps
The vast majority of apps claiming to generate free Robux are scams. These apps often require users to provide their Roblox login credentials, which can lead to account theft. Some may also install malware or adware on the user's device.
These malicious apps often promise unlimited Robux in exchange for completing simple tasks. This is a classic red flag, as generating Robux without authorization is a violation of Roblox's terms of service and technically impossible.
Even if an app doesn't steal account information, it may subject users to relentless advertising or require them to download other potentially harmful applications. The "rewards" rarely materialize, leaving users with nothing but wasted time and a potentially compromised device.
Phishing and Account Takeovers
Phishing is a common tactic used by scammers targeting Roblox players. They create fake websites that look identical to the official Roblox site and trick users into entering their login information. This allows scammers to steal accounts and potentially drain them of Robux or valuable in-game items.
These phishing sites are often promoted through social media or Robux generator apps. Users should always verify the website address before entering their login credentials.
Roblox's Official Stance
Roblox Corporation has consistently warned users against using third-party Robux generators. Their official website states clearly that there are no legitimate ways to get free Robux besides participating in official Roblox events or contests.
The company actively works to identify and shut down fake Robux generators and phishing websites. They also encourage users to report any suspicious activity.
Using unofficial methods to obtain Robux can result in account suspension or permanent ban from the platform. This is a significant risk that players should consider before attempting to use Robux generators.
Furthermore, Roblox's terms of service explicitly prohibit the buying, selling, or trading of Robux outside of the official Roblox platform. Engaging in such activities can also lead to account suspension.
Protecting Yourself and Your Children
Parents play a crucial role in protecting their children from Robux scams. It's important to educate children about the dangers of clicking on suspicious links and sharing their login information.
Consider using parental control software to restrict access to potentially harmful websites and apps. Also, regularly review your child's online activity and have open conversations about online safety.
Encourage children to report any suspicious activity or encounters to a trusted adult. Teaching them to be skeptical of offers that seem too good to be true can help prevent them from falling victim to scams.
